Output 365778edb5c8a558bd1ac803705fc81c0e95168b6d1583cb5e0d6c572686e43b:0

value
7176543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b277fab2f3b76303f0006e300364f42d7a6d59a OP_EQUAL
address
32hzg58jdjh4pYLWcv6tXzaVSpAxmia3YN
transaction
365778edb5c8a558bd1ac803705fc81c0e95168b6d1583cb5e0d6c572686e43b
confirmations
512301
spent
true